Q3 Planning Note — Heads of Department, Orvenstad Logistics

Team, the sale of our Pallet Refurb unit to Greymoor Industrial is tracking toward a Q3 close. Expect some staff transfers and a short systems handover window in August. Keep this tight until the announcement lands. The confidential note on our broader plans follows below.

confidential, yahip-hagug: Gorixax Logistics plans to lower the Ulaael list price by 26.6 percent in October. The pricing group signed off on a budget of $199.9 million for Project Holix. The renewal with Kasdorox Systems closes at $137.5 million a year, 8.2 percent above the last contract. Project Lamion slips by a full year because of the audit delay.

Handover note — from Marta Quill to Deshan Rowe

Deshan, as I step back from the regional brief, one thing to flag for the branch managers: Kestrelline Foods now accounts for nearly 40% of our wholesale volume. If they wobble, we wobble. I've started spreading orders toward Pellow & Grange and the Tarnbrook co-op, but it's slow going. Please keep the teams pushing smaller accounts rather than chasing Kestrelline top-ups. The confidential outline of where we want the mix to land next year follows below.

confidential, kagep-kahof: Druokax Systems plans to lower the Ulaath list price by 53 percent in March.

Changed defaults in Splitfork, our assignment service. Bucketing now uses sticky hashing per account instead of per session, and the holdout slice grew from 2% to 5%. Callers relying on session-level reassignment must opt in explicitly. Review the diff against the new baseline; the updated default configuration is listed below.

config for tagep-kajof:
[casir]
port = 6379
region = south-1
host = casir.paliqdyn.example
team = tamax
timeout_ms = 250
retries = 2

## Tuning: image slimming (Ferndale build pipeline)

If you're new to the Ferndale pipeline: the slimming stage strips debug symbols, deduplicates layers, and rejects images over a size budget. These steps run in order and each has a knob — compression level, layer cache size, and the hard size ceiling. Don't loosen the ceiling to unblock a build; fix the image instead. Budgets are enforced per target environment. The current values for each knob are defined immediately below.

tuning constants:
QUOTAS = {
    "druwyn": 5,
    "holix": 5,
    "zorath": 5,
    "holwyn": 10,
}